Parents of Bondi attacker Joel Cauchi share struggle with son’s Mental Illness

Michele Cauchi, the mother of Joel Cauchi, the Bondi attacker, has spoken out about her son’s actions. She expressed confusion about what motivated her son’s attack, stating that he was raised with love. According to Michele, Joel had been requesting a reduction in his medication over several years before leaving the family home.

She described the situation as a parent’s worst nightmare, especially when dealing with a child with mental illness. Michele extended her sympathy to the victims of her son’s actions, expressing belief that Joel would have been devastated by what he had done if he were in his right mind. She emphasised that he seemed to have been triggered into psychosis, losing touch with reality.

Michele mentioned that Joel had many friends until he fell ill. She urged others with family members facing mental health issues to seek support, emphasising that they were ordinary parents who did their best to raise their son.

Andrew Cauchi, Joel’s father, echoed similar sentiments, describing his son as a “very sick boy” who had let himself down. He expressed love and heartbreak for Joel, despite the devastation caused by his actions.

The Cauchis expressed sorrow for the victims and their families, with Andrew apologising and expressing devastation for the tragedy. He revealed that they had done everything they could to care for Joel before he stopped taking his medication and left for Brisbane.

Andrew recounted his efforts to support Joel, emphasising his love for his son and the pain of seeing him struggle with mental illness. He lamented that Joel had “let himself down” after being taken off medication when he appeared to be doing well.

Joel Cauchi, 40, targeted women in the attack at Westfield Bondi Junction, which ended when he was shot dead by police.

Joel had been diagnosed with schizophrenia, a severe mental disorder characterised by episodes of psychosis, manifesting in altered perceptions of reality. Symptoms include delusions, hallucinations, disorganised thinking, paranoid thoughts, social withdrawal, a lack of emotional expression, and unusual physical behaviours.
